LET’S TALK ABOUT THE BASICS OF DISINFECTION

It is simple, really: cleaning and disinfecting are the single most important actions to maintain the well-being and health of high-producing animals - such as dairy cows. This is especially the case in intensive modern animal housing where high density and high productivity increase the infection pressure.

Only thorough cleaning and adapted disinfection decreases the pathogen level and prevents or breaks the disease cycle.

And that’s not just us talking. World leading biosecurity authorities such as Biocheck have emphasized time and again the importance of cleaning and disinfection.

TEMPERATURE RANGE

Virocid® can be used between 4 °C – 60 °C, and even in freezing temperatures, by adding propylene glycol.

Also tested in seawater (CFR Test University of Bergen, Norway). Test available upon request.

NON-CORROSIVE

Virocid® at 0,5%, after 1000h of immersion causes no corrosion on surfaces commonly used in livestock industries and therefore can be used safely.

test

Corrosivity test done at CIRLAM laboratory based on UN no. ST/SG/AC.10/11/Rev.4 guidelines.

* considered norm for the ADR transport law. 0,1mm/year gives a visual appearance of beginning corrosivity

In dilution, Virocid® has a pH around neutral.

STABILITY

The dilution of 0,5% (1:200) and 1% (1:100) is stable in water of 6 °C (43 F), 25 °C (77 F) and 40 °C (104 F) during 4 weeks.

The concentrate has a shelf life of 3 years at an average temperature of 25 °C.

Official bodies confirm the effectiveness of VIROCID®
Image
TEST
Text

The Plum Island Animal Disease Center (PIADC) has found VIROCID® to be one of few disinfectants capable of eliminating African Swine Fever Virus on hard surface to EPA satisfactory level. The Plum Island Animal Disease Center (PIADC)’s sole purpose is to protect US livestock from exposure to Foreign Animal Diseases (FADs) that might threaten the country’s livestock industries, food security and economy. PIADC tested a whole range of disinfectants on their effectiveness in eliminating ASF. Virocid®, manufactured by CID LINES, An Ecolab Company, scored the best results.

US Homeland Security study shows VIROCID® is an effective disinfectant on porous surfaces.

Left column
Text

VIROCID® APPLICATION

Performance on concrete

The efficacy test conducted at the PIADC was published during a series of webinars held on 26-30 October 2020, and evaluated a number of commercially available disinfectants in the US (USDA APHIS listed disinfectants for use against ASF). Virocid®, a prominent product from CID LINES, An Ecolab Company, was one of 6 products in the test (2).

The efficacy evaluation, made by The Department of Homeland Security Science and Technology Directorate, Plum Island Animal Disease Center, USA, showed that Virocid® was able to reach the US EPA product efficacy cut-off point on a hard, porous surface.

This is significant, as concrete’s high pH means the virus can reoccur on untreated surfaces.

Performance on stainless steel

On top of its results on concrete, Virocid® performed as well on stainless steel (hard surface) as the two USDA APHIS listed disinfectants for use against ASF.

Myth No. 1: ‘Cleaning equals disinfecting.’

 

FALSE!

FACT. Centers for disease control and prevention stated that cleaning refers to eliminating dirt and dust from surfaces, which expels, but does not kill, some of the microbes. As we said earlier, cleaning is key since it decreases the number of bacteria in the environment.

 

Disinfecting, on the other hand, kills germs on surfaces by immersing them with chemicals. Both cleaning and disinfecting play an important role in keeping your farm clean and sanitized. The rule is always: cleaning first, then disinfecting.

Myth No. 3:’ If a disinfectant kills bacteria effectively, it must be toxic.’

 

FALSE!

FACT.  the amount of glutaraldehyde in aerosol is below the Maximum Exposure Limit and VIROCID® is classified as safe to use for humans in a dilution of 1:200 (0,5%), VIROCID® contains no carcinogenic formaldehyde nor toxic phenols, without compromising germicidal efficacy.

VIROCID® is readily biodegradable for more than 90% after 28 days, according to European Commission directives and the OECD (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development).
